Evaluation Criterion

During the test administration, each student will receive a worksheet and an evaluation sheet that they will give to me, the teacher, at the end of the test.  Students will receive credit for participating in the test for that day and will also receive extra credit for performing at the passing level for high school students.  For this test there are two types of criterion: Needs Improvement and Satisfactory.  Students will be told to not lift there upper body more than 12 inches because it is a risk for potential injury.

** 6 - 12 Inches is the PASSING standard for both boys and girls K - 8
** 9 - 12 Inches is the PASSING standard for both boys and girls 9 - 12
